]> git.sur5r.net Git - bacula/bacula/commitdiff
Improve performance for MySQL with update stats command
authorEric Bollengier <eric@eb.homelinux.org>
Wed, 16 Jun 2010 09:35:18 +0000 (11:35 +0200)
committerEric Bollengier <eric@eb.homelinux.org>
Mon, 2 Aug 2010 14:53:53 +0000 (16:53 +0200)
bacula/src/cats/make_mysql_tables.in
bacula/src/cats/update_mysql_tables.in

index 7fc01b3126e13d8d66cfcdee26c6fd2e66280bee..9fcd97ee904e85db89f449e6a6ea719e0c1cbc4a 100644 (file)
@@ -181,6 +181,7 @@ CREATE TABLE JobHisto (
    HasCache TINYINT DEFAULT 0,
    Reviewed TINYINT DEFAULT 0,
    Comment BLOB,
+   INDEX (JobId),
    INDEX (StartTime)
    );
 
index 22db77c3f4a125a800015986b3a9488da443441d..f1b5e16463cfc413b7c00035c0e7924b2a9de0e0 100644 (file)
@@ -42,6 +42,8 @@ CREATE TABLE RestoreObject (
    INDEX (JobId)
 );
 
+CREATE INDEX jobhisto_jobid_idx ON JobHisto (JobId);
+
 DELETE FROM Version;
 INSERT INTO Version (VersionId) VALUES (13);